public class Binomial
extends jdistlib.generic.GenericDistribution
| Modifier and Type | Class and Description |
|---|---|
static class |
Binomial.RandomState |
| Modifier and Type | Field and Description |
|---|---|
protected double |
n |
protected double |
p |
protected Binomial.RandomState |
state |
| Constructor and Description |
|---|
Binomial(double n,
double p) |
| Modifier and Type | Method and Description |
|---|---|
static Binomial.RandomState |
create_random_state() |
double |
cumulative(double p,
boolean lower_tail,
boolean log_p) |
static double |
cumulative(double x,
double n,
double p,
boolean lower_tail,
boolean log_p) |
static double |
density_raw(double x,
double n,
double p,
double q,
boolean log_p) |
double |
density(double x,
boolean log) |
static double |
density(double x,
double n,
double p,
boolean give_log) |
double |
quantile(double q,
boolean lower_tail,
boolean log_p) |
static double |
quantile(double p,
double n,
double pr,
boolean lower_tail,
boolean log_p) |
double |
random() |
static double |
random(double nin,
double pp,
jdistlib.rng.RandomEngine random) |
static double |
random(double nin,
double pp,
jdistlib.rng.RandomEngine random,
Binomial.RandomState state) |
double[] |
random(int ct) |
static double[] |
random(int n,
double nin,
double pp,
jdistlib.rng.RandomEngine random) |
static double[] |
random(int n,
double nin,
double pp,
jdistlib.rng.RandomEngine random,
Binomial.RandomState state) |
cumulative_hazard, cumulative_hazard, cumulative, cumulative, cumulative, density, density, getRandomEngine, hazard, hazard, inverse_survival, inverse_survival, quantile, quantile, quantile, random, setRandomEngine, survival, survival, survivalprotected double n
protected double p
protected Binomial.RandomState state
public static final Binomial.RandomState create_random_state()
public static final double density_raw(double x,
double n,
double p,
double q,
boolean log_p)
public static final double density(double x,
double n,
double p,
boolean give_log)
public static final double cumulative(double x,
double n,
double p,
boolean lower_tail,
boolean log_p)
public static final double quantile(double p,
double n,
double pr,
boolean lower_tail,
boolean log_p)
public static final double random(double nin,
double pp,
jdistlib.rng.RandomEngine random)
public static final double random(double nin,
double pp,
jdistlib.rng.RandomEngine random,
Binomial.RandomState state)
public static final double[] random(int n,
double nin,
double pp,
jdistlib.rng.RandomEngine random)
public static final double[] random(int n,
double nin,
double pp,
jdistlib.rng.RandomEngine random,
Binomial.RandomState state)
public double density(double x,
boolean log)
density in class jdistlib.generic.GenericDistributionpublic double cumulative(double p,
boolean lower_tail,
boolean log_p)
cumulative in class jdistlib.generic.GenericDistributionpublic double quantile(double q,
boolean lower_tail,
boolean log_p)
quantile in class jdistlib.generic.GenericDistributionpublic double random()
random in class jdistlib.generic.GenericDistributionpublic double[] random(int ct)
random in class jdistlib.generic.GenericDistributionCopyright © 2017. All rights reserved.